Why Choose Heat Treatments?
Heat treatments are gaining popularity as a preferred method for bed bug removal, especially in Broken Arrow. This method involves raising the temperature of an infested area to a level that is hazardous to bed bugs while keeping your belongings safe. It’s a chemical-free approach that lets families return to their homes without worry about harmful pesticides.
According to a study by the University of Kentucky on the effectiveness of heat treatments, elevating temperatures to around 120 degrees Fahrenheit can eliminate bed bugs and their eggs in a single treatment. How Does a Broken Arrow Exterminator Conduct Heat Treatments?
When you hire a Broken Arrow Exterminator, the first step will typically involve a thorough inspection of your home. This process allows the exterminator to identify the severity of the infestation and determine the most effective treatment plan.
Once the inspection is complete, the exterminator will use specialized equipment to raise the temperature in infested areas. This process usually takes several hours and requires careful monitoring to ensure all corners of the room reach a sufficient temperature. After the treatment, your exterminator might suggest certain follow-up measures to guarantee the bugs do not return.
